
Blood and Sand
Named for the 1922 bullfighting epic Blood and Sand: equal parts Scotch, cherry liqueur, sweet vermouth and orange juice — rich, rounded and impossibly smooth, an IBA classic that shows how versatile whisky can be.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do you make a Blood and Sand?
A Blood and Sand is made by shaken method in 5 step(s). 1) Chill a coupe glass in advance: fill it with ice water or pop it in the freezer. 2) Add the Scotch whisky, cherry liqueur, sweet vermouth and fresh orange juice to a shaker. 3) Fill with ice and shake hard for 10-12 seconds until the tin frosts over. 4) Double-strain into the chilled coupe glass. 5) Garnish with a maraschino cherry and serve immediately, ice-cold. What ingredients are in a Blood and Sand?
A Blood and Sand needs 5 ingredient(s): Scotch Whisky 25ml, Cherry Heering Liqueur 25ml, Sweet Vermouth 25ml, Fresh Orange Juice 25ml, Maraschino Cherry (Garnish) 1 for garnish.
What does a Blood and Sand taste like? How strong is it?
Flavor profile: Classic Balance, Fruity, Rich & Smooth. Strength: 18-28% ABV.
What glass is a Blood and Sand served in?
A Blood and Sand is typically served in a coupe glass, prepared by the shaken method.
